Hotpot is delicious! Portion is adequate. Comparable to Boiling Point but less expensive. Menu is pre-Covid pricing....more bang for the buck.👍. There are 4 price options: mini, regular, upgrade (quality meat), and premium (highest quality meat). Regular or higher option comes with free beverage. Premium include ice cream, and all you can eat rice or noodles. This establishment could use extra help. Food took a bit long to serve. Condiments, sauces, and beverages are self-serve. There's parking adjacent to the building. Cash only.

Theres a small parking lot and plenty of street parking. It got busy around 7:30-8pm and so we put our name down and waited. We also noticed a CASH ONLY sign so thank goodness there was a Chase across the street. This is a small restaurant that probably fits about 25 people. Some tables are long so they might seat you cafeteria style. The customer service was really friendly. I ordered the upgraded Malibu Shabu Shabu. There are 3 options with each hot pot: regular, upgrade - comes with more meat and premium - comes with even more meat. It also comes with a free drink!! I THINK they were - iced tea, peach iced tea and lychee lemonade. This place was pretty good and the proportions are generous for one person and not stuffed with cabbage.
